Installation and Maintenance of Electric Log Inserts

Installing an electric log insert is generally a straightforward process, often requiring minimal tools and technical expertise. Most models are designed for plug-and-play functionality, meaning they simply need to be placed within the fireplace opening and connected to a standard electrical outlet. However, it’s crucial to ensure that the outlet is properly grounded and capable of handling the insert’s power requirements. Consulting a qualified electrician is advisable if you’re unsure about your electrical system.

Before installation, carefully measure the dimensions of your fireplace opening to ensure that the electric log insert fits snugly and securely. Adequate clearance around the insert is also essential to prevent overheating and ensure proper ventilation. Refer to the manufacturer’s instructions for specific clearance requirements and recommended installation procedures. Ignoring these guidelines can compromise the insert’s performance and safety.

Maintenance of electric log inserts is remarkably simple compared to traditional fireplaces. Since there’s no combustion involved, there’s no need for chimney cleaning or ash removal. The primary maintenance task is dusting the unit regularly to prevent dust accumulation on the heating element and flame effect components. Periodically inspecting the electrical cord and connections for any signs of damage is also recommended.

In the event of a malfunction, it’s crucial to consult the manufacturer’s troubleshooting guide or contact a qualified technician for repairs. Attempting to repair the insert yourself without proper knowledge and experience can be dangerous and may void the warranty. With proper installation and regular maintenance, an electric log insert can provide years of reliable and enjoyable use.

Features to Consider When Choosing an Electric Log Insert

Selecting the right electric log insert requires careful consideration of several key features that impact performance, aesthetics, and convenience. The first and perhaps most important factor is the heat output, measured in BTUs (British Thermal Units). Determine the size of the room you intend to heat and choose an insert with a BTU rating that adequately matches the space. Overestimating the heating capacity can lead to overheating and wasted energy, while underestimating it will result in insufficient warmth.

The realism of the flame effect is another crucial feature that significantly contributes to the ambiance of the insert. Look for models that offer adjustable flame brightness, speed, and color options to create a customized and realistic fire display. Features such as pulsating embers and three-dimensional flame effects can further enhance the authenticity of the fire experience. Consider inserts that use LED technology, which is energy-efficient and produces a vibrant and long-lasting flame.

Remote control functionality adds convenience and allows you to adjust the heat output, flame settings, and timer functions from the comfort of your couch. Some advanced models even offer smartphone app integration, enabling you to control the insert remotely and set custom schedules. This level of control provides greater flexibility and energy efficiency.

Finally, consider safety features such as overheat protection and cool-touch housing. Overheat protection automatically shuts off the insert if it detects excessive temperatures, preventing potential hazards. Cool-touch housing ensures that the exterior surfaces of the insert remain cool to the touch, minimizing the risk of burns, especially for households with children or pets. These safety features are essential for ensuring peace of mind and preventing accidents.

Comparing Electric Log Inserts to Other Heating Options

Electric log inserts stand out as a distinctive heating solution when contrasted with alternative options like central heating, space heaters, and gas fireplaces. Central heating, while effective for whole-house warming, often lacks the zone-specific control and visual appeal offered by electric log inserts. Using central heating to warm only a single room can be energy-inefficient, making an electric log insert a more targeted and cost-effective choice for supplemental heating.

Space heaters, while portable and relatively inexpensive, typically lack the aesthetic charm and realistic fire display of electric log inserts. Furthermore, some space heaters can be noisy and prone to tipping, posing potential safety risks. Electric log inserts offer a safer and more visually pleasing alternative for localized heating, providing both warmth and ambiance.

Compared to gas fireplaces, electric log inserts offer a cleaner and more environmentally friendly heating option. Gas fireplaces require venting to the outside and produce combustion byproducts, including carbon monoxide, which can be harmful to indoor air quality. Electric log inserts, on the other hand, produce zero emissions and require no venting, making them a safer and more sustainable choice for homeowners concerned about their environmental impact.

The installation and maintenance requirements also differ significantly between electric log inserts and other heating options. Central heating systems require professional installation and regular maintenance, while gas fireplaces necessitate chimney cleaning and gas line inspections. Electric log inserts, in contrast, are generally easy to install and require minimal maintenance, making them a more convenient and hassle-free heating solution for many homeowners.

Heating Capacity and BTU Output: Matching Heat to Space

The heating capacity of an electric log insert is a critical determinant of its ability to effectively warm the intended space. Measured in British Thermal Units (BTUs), this metric indicates the amount of heat the insert can generate per hour. A higher BTU output generally translates to a greater heating capacity, allowing the insert to warm a larger area more effectively. Consider the square footage of the room or area you intend to heat and compare it to the manufacturer’s recommendations for the insert’s heating range. Overestimating the required BTU output can lead to excessive energy consumption and unnecessary heating, while underestimating it will result in inadequate warming and user dissatisfaction.

Industry standards typically recommend around 10 BTUs per square foot of living space in moderately insulated environments. However, this is a general guideline and should be adjusted based on factors such as insulation levels, window quantity and quality, and ceiling height. Data from the U.S. Department of Energy indicates that homes with poor insulation may require significantly higher BTU outputs to achieve the same level of warmth compared to well-insulated homes. Furthermore, electric log inserts are generally designed for supplemental heating rather than primary heating sources. Consider the existing heating system in your home and use the electric log insert to supplement it during colder periods or to provide localized warmth in specific areas.

How much heat can I expect from an electric log insert, and what room size can it effectively heat?

The heating capacity of an electric log insert is generally measured in BTUs (British Thermal Units). Most standard electric log inserts offer between 4,000 and 5,000 BTUs, which is typically sufficient to heat a room of approximately 400 to 500 square feet. However, the effectiveness of the heating will depend on several factors, including the insulation of your home, the height of the ceilings, and the climate you live in. A poorly insulated room will require a more powerful insert to achieve the same level of warmth as a well-insulated space.

It’s important to consider that electric log inserts are primarily designed for supplemental heating, rather than being the sole source of warmth for an entire home. While some higher-end models may offer greater BTU output, it’s generally more energy-efficient and cost-effective to use a central heating system for whole-house heating. The electric log insert is best suited for creating a cozy and inviting atmosphere in a specific room, while also providing a boost of warmth when needed.

Are electric log inserts energy-efficient, and what are the running costs associated with them?

Electric log inserts are generally considered to be relatively energy-efficient compared to traditional wood-burning fireplaces, primarily because they don’t lose heat through a chimney. They operate on electricity, and most models have a heating element that efficiently converts electrical energy into heat. However, the actual energy efficiency and running costs will depend on several factors, including the wattage of the insert, the amount of time you use it, and your local electricity rates.

To estimate the running costs, you can use the following formula: (Wattage / 1000) x Hours of Use x Electricity Rate per kWh. For example, a 1500-watt insert used for 4 hours a day with an electricity rate of $0.15 per kWh would cost approximately $0.90 per day to operate. It’s also worth noting that many electric log inserts have a flame-only mode, which allows you to enjoy the visual ambiance without the heating function, consuming very little electricity. Over time, the reduced fuel costs (compared to wood) and the elimination of chimney cleaning can contribute to significant savings.

How easy is it to install an electric log insert, and are there any specific requirements?

One of the major advantages of electric log inserts is their ease of installation. Unlike traditional fireplaces, they don’t require venting, chimneys, or gas lines, making the installation process relatively simple and straightforward. Most electric log inserts are designed to be placed directly into an existing fireplace opening, provided it meets the minimum size requirements specified by the manufacturer.

Typically, all you need to do is ensure that the fireplace opening is clean and free of debris, and then carefully place the insert inside. The electric log insert then simply plugs into a standard electrical outlet. However, it’s essential to check the electrical requirements of the insert and ensure that the outlet can handle the load. In some cases, you may need to upgrade the wiring or install a dedicated circuit. Always consult the manufacturer’s instructions for specific installation guidelines and safety precautions.

What is the expected lifespan of an electric log insert, and what kind of maintenance is required?

The lifespan of an electric log insert can vary depending on the quality of the unit, the frequency of use, and how well it’s maintained. However, a well-maintained electric log insert can typically last for 5 to 10 years or even longer. The LED lights used in many modern inserts have a long lifespan, often rated for tens of thousands of hours of use.

Maintenance requirements for electric log inserts are minimal compared to traditional fireplaces. The primary maintenance task is to regularly clean the unit to remove dust and debris, which can accumulate on the log set, heating element, and fan. You can usually do this with a soft cloth or vacuum cleaner. It’s also essential to check the electrical connections periodically to ensure they are secure and in good condition. Avoid using harsh chemicals or abrasive cleaners, as these can damage the finish or components of the insert.
